NANY 2021: yaydl
Tuxman:
NANY 2021 Entry Information
Application Name yet another youtube down loader Version 0.3.0 changes regularly Short Description does what it says Supported OSes developed on macOS, compiled for Windows 10 11, but in theory, yaydl should run where Rust is available Web Page https://code.rosaelefanten.org/yaydl Downloadvia cargo: cargo install yaydlSystem Requirements
* ffmpeg. unless you can live with the default video formats and don’t ever use the audio-only option.Author that would be me
Description
You know what was missing? A tool to download YouTube video files! Here’s mine.
Features
[*]Can download videos.
[*]Can optionally keep only the audio part of them.
[*]Could convert the resulting file to something else (requires ffmpeg).
[*]Comes as a single binary (once compiled) - take it everywhere on your thumbdrive, no Python cruft required.
[/list]
Non-features
The list of features is deliberately kept short:
[*]No output quality choice. yaydl assumes that your internet connection is good enough, or else you would stream, not download.
[*]No complex filters. This is a downloading tool.
[*]No image file support. Videos only.
[/list]
Missing features (patches are welcome)
[*]yaydl currently ignores video meta data (except the title) unless they are a part of the video file.
[*]Playlists are not fully supported yet.
[*]More supported sites: Possible, but not implemented yet. Check the README!
[/list]
Usage
--- ---USAGE:
yaydl [FLAGS] [OPTIONS] <URL>
ARGS:
<URL> Sets the input URL to use
FLAGS:
-h, --help Prints help information
-x, --only-audio Only keeps the audio stream
-v, --verbose Talks more while the URL is processed
-V, --version Prints version information
OPTIONS:
-f, --audio-format <AUDIO> Sets the target audio format (only if --only-audio is used).
Specify the file extension here (defaults to "mp3").
-o, --output <OUTPUTFILE> Sets the output file name
